Plot summary: The powerful Kingdom of Pars was very prosperous in culture and economy because the continental highway connecting the East and the West ran through the kingdom. The capital, Yekpatana, was as prosperous as the capital of the "Silk Kingdom" in the East. However, in the 320th year of the Parsian calendar, Pars was invaded by the Western barbarian "Lucidania". Pars, which could have easily won, was defeated in the battle of the plain "Atropatini" because of the rebellion of one of the ten thousand knights. The continental power fell on the edge of extinction in one day. The defeated King of Pars, Andracorras III, was captured by a knight wearing a silver mask while fleeing. The crown prince Arslan, who was on his first expedition, escaped from the chaotic battlefield with the help of his loyal minister Daron, and finally went to Mount Basil to find Narsas, who was not valued by the king. With the help of the two wise and brave men, as well as other loyal ministers who defected to his side, the crown prince Arslan embarked on the arduous road to restore his country...
